bonjour tlm,
j'ai un projet en c# sous visual compact framework 2.0
j'ai 3 classe "FORM"
et je souhaiterai qu'il puisse lire/ecrit sur une meme variable.
comment je peux faire ca svp?
merci
bonjour tlm,
j'ai un projet en c# sous visual compact framework 2.0
j'ai 3 classe "FORM"
et je souhaiterai qu'il puisse lire/ecrit sur une meme variable.
comment je peux faire ca svp?
merci
comme ca par exemple :
Sinon, une autre solution serait d'avoir une classe Static qui contient
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19 static class Program { // definition de variable globale ici (enfin, pourquoi pas ;).... static public int HelloWorld = 10; /// <summary> /// The main entry point for the application. /// </summary> [STAThread] static void Main() { Application.EnableVisualStyles(); Application.SetCompatibleTextRenderingDefault(false); Application.Run(new Form1()); } }
les variables que tu veux exposer...
The Monz, Toulouse
justement, est ce qu'on peut modifier les variables d'une classe statique ?
Peut on avoir des propriétés statiques modifiables ???
beh oui, like this :
Le fait qu'une variable soit "static" veut dire qu'elle est alloué en mémoire
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7 static private int toto = 10; static public int Toto { get { return toto; } set { toto = value; } }
à un emplacement et qu'elle n'en bougera pas de toute la vie du programme...
C'est juste cela que ca veut dire static... (entre autre )
The Monz, Toulouse
oki merci bcp ^^
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.
Partager